Swordfish is a mild-tasting white fish with a meaty and firm texture. It's found in Atlantic, Pacific and Mediterranean waters. This meaty fish is protein-rich and a great source of B12, zinc, and Omega 3. You'll find it sold in white steaks, typically about 1 inch in thickness. Spoon over fish. 5min per side at medium high is ... WebJun 25, 2024 · How to BBQ Swordfish. The firm, robust texture of swordfish makes it perfect for the BBQ. It will cook over hot coals in no time at all and because it is mild in flavour, is the perfect base for marinades and flavourings. But… keep a watchful eye. Cooked well, swordfish should be moist and succulent. Over-cooked, it will be dry and unappetising. WebDirections. Heat the sunflower o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
